It’s not often you get a single add-on pack that generates about as much hype and expectation as a full blown Christmas release, but Infinity Ward and Activision have managed to create a points sapping epidemic by making the first map pack for Modern Warfare 2. This isn’t without a slight degree of controversy, as many people question the value placed upon this expansion due to the higher than expected price tag, bearing in mind that maps have already been played countless time on the previous Modern Warfare. Crash and Overgrown aside though, can this really stand up to a 1200 point purchase?
